Learn more about Bing search results hereOrganizing and summarizing search results for youTo seal cracks in concrete driveway, you need to:- Clean the area thoroughly using a broom, a brush, or a screwdriver to remove the dirt and debris from the cracks.
- Choose the right sealer for the size of the cracks. You can use urethane caulk, dry concrete mix, or concrete patching compound.
- Apply the sealer into the cracks using a caulk gun, a trowel, or your fingers. Make sure the sealer is flush with the surface and beveled if it's against the house.
- Let the sealer dry and cure according to the manufacturer's instructions.

Solved! What to Do About Cracks in a Concrete Driveway
Small cracks here and there that are narrower than 1⁄4 inch are most likely the result of shrinkage as the driveway cured. Like spider web cracks, these small cracks do not indicate a larger problem, and they often show up soon after the concrete is poured.
